4.0 excellent | FCY | August 31st 10 | Linkin Park mix Meteora and Minutes to Midnight with beats from Beck and guitar play from Soundgarden, preparing to release the most out of the ordinary, experimental, yet extremely focused concept album of the year. Mike Shinoda's lead singer role, featuring hardcore reggae-style rapping and soft singing, together with Bennington's backing vocals, consisting of experimental rapping and saddistic screaming on "Blackout" and melodramatic soft undertones, are the definite highlights of the record. Instrumentals are rather dancy, much more diverse and electronica influenced as there are no usual song structures present throughout the album, the listener hardly being able to notice a chorus or a verse. While the obvious absence of heavy guitars is somewhat disturbing, the solo in "Iredescent" should be a dull lift-up. Since I've had the opportunity to listen to this album only once at a pre-listening event, the album is hard to judge. The record requires more than one listen to fully absorb Linkin Park's new approach, so I'll save my final thoughts for a review next week.
